ERDOGAN’S STATEMENT CONSTITUTES SERIOUS VIOLATION OF HUMAN RIGHTS, FRENCH SOCIALISTS SAY

/PanARMENIAN.Net/ The Socialist Party of France has slammed Turkish
Prime Minister Recep Tayyip Erdogan’s threat to evict nearly 100 000
undocumented Armenian workers in retaliation for a vote in Parliament
Swedish recognizing the Armenian Genocide of 1915.

"If executed, the threat would constitute a serious violation of human
rights and is contrary to humanist values of the European Union that
Turkey’s ambition to join," said Jean-Christophe Cambadelis, National
Secretary for Europe and International Relations.

"The Socialist Party, originally a law in France, recognized the
Armenian Genocide and strongly condemns the statement of the Prime
Minister of Turkey. If the Democratic Turkey is not responsible for
the crimes committed by the Ottoman Empire, so recognition of Genocide
is a moral requirement," he said.
